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5712 71950913 50048715807 5162
74257918814 488995
74257918814 488995
29 738445030 0219268 746182
All about undefined
Interested in learning more?
74257918814 488995
29 738445030 0219268 746182
See more
2123 73 2229965464
7394 76 18454348166
See more
65453830 13221
0889492 03863 7506075
See more